【问题标题】:Exclude bot users from slack search api results从松弛搜索 api 结果中排除机器人用户
【发布时间】:2020-05-22 00:39:21
【问题描述】:

在松弛的 UI 中,当我进行搜索时,它会向 search.modules 端点发出请求。还可以选择从结果中排除应用程序和机器人,这将转换为该 api 端点的布尔 POST 参数。

https://api.slack.com/methods没有列出这样的方法,只有search.messagessearch.filessearch.all

如何使用 API 进行搜索,但排除机器人帐户?我是否需要利用这个看似隐藏的search.modules(机器人帐户可能无法访问)?有没有比列出机器人列表并从搜索结果中手动过滤它们更好的方法?

【问题讨论】:

    标签: slack slack-api


    【解决方案1】:

    嗯,它不在任何地方的文档中,但我可以使用 search.messages api 通过将 search_exclude_bots=True 添加到我的 POST 数据中来实现这一点。

    由于这是无证的,我很好奇用户是否应该使用这个参数,以及它是否会在未来以一种破坏性的方式改变。

    【讨论】:

      猜你喜欢
      • 2017-03-20
      • 2016-08-07
      • 1970-01-01
      • 2023-03-24
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多